What Is Allowed At The Border Checkpoints
 22.07.08
Insurance vendors, currency exchanges, and even coffee vending machines are no longer allowed at border points into Russia.
Prime-Minister Vladimir Putin signed an exhaustive list of commercial activities that will be allowed at such border checkpoints. The list includes medical stations, duty-free shops and communications agencies. Public catering services will be allowed only in airports and marinas. Banking services are limited to those processing customs fees and other payments from individuals.
